so... can u actually take it with you on the plane???????

No...it has to go under the plane with your checked luggage and then there are tons of requirements such as you have to have it pre-approved with the airline and they only allow a certain amount of ammo to be transported with it. The rest will have to be UPSed (Fed-Ex won't do ammo the last time I checked.)

Yes, sorry that was my idea. Take it on the plane in your luggage. It is a pain in the ass, but lots cheaper and less likely to get stolen/"lost" than sending it usps or fed-ex.

I've done it a few times, mind you that has been a couple of years but I doubt it's changed much. Call the airline you are flying, ask them what you need to do to take it. see if they have a website with the info on it also or if they can send you something, that way you can review to make sure you don't violate any laws. I know you need a lockable case, it has to be empty, the ammo can't be with the gun (I think), and TSA has to check it out before you board, and they'll put a sticker or card on it to show that it's approved.
